Market Structures - Essay ExampleAn oligopoly, on the other hand is a market federal agency where there are few competitors in the market, but each competitor is large enough to affect the market price. The concentration of power rests on a few players now, rather than just one. And like in the case of the monopolist, while there is competition already, each player still has enough power to conquer production, affect quantity of output or raise prices.While there has been a very fine line between an oligopoly and cartel, the difference lies between the formalization of mathematical groups that comprise the competition to serve a common purpose. In an oligopoly, the individual players have enough power to affect prices in the market. When these players form a group of a common purpose in hostel to regulate the supply in a certain market, thus actively controlling the price it becomes a cartel. The difference between an oligopoly and a cartel lies in forming an association between the players to limit the competition.An example of a monopoly is a power distribution company that serves a certain area. Monopolies of these sorts are apparent in networks, in order to ensure a certain level of supply to keep prices from fluctuating and hurting consumers.The resound service industry is an example of oligopoly. The players in the industry can affect the market price of various telephone services by preempting to control prices of a service, which could lead the other competitors to either follow or counter the attack.The Organization of Petroleum Exporting Countries is a good example of a cartel. In order to regulate the supply in the oil market, these countries form in order to produce a quota, or certain amount of supply in conformity to their contribution to the supply target of the cartel.Monopolies and oligopolies over time accumulate as much resources that are enough to fund breakthrough scientific discoveries and research and

Independent topic - Speech or Presentation ExampleIn professional polling the importance of have validity is immeasurable. The first tint is to fully identify the sampling frame from the population that the poll seeks to represent. This is followed by a random selection of a small percentage from within the sampling frame to represent the entire population targeted by that poll. Random here implies that everyone has an equal chance to be selected and this can only be graspd if the method elect to identify individuals to be interviewed is free of bias. Even though Statistics postulates that the actual number of people interviewed for a given sample is less important than the soundness of randomness employed in the process, you still need to balance the economic cost of sample sizes with the desired level of accuracy required. Accuracy of plus or deduction three percentage points margin of error is the acceptable level for professional polls.Once the individual to be interviewed h as been identified it is important not to change the selected mortal so as to eliminate possibility of bias. In the case of telephone sampling this would involve performing call-backs until such a time that selected individual is available. However, to a greater extent importantly for the interview is the wording of the questions and the order in which they are set to be answered. Crafting fair and objective questions requires extensive knowledge of public opinion, care and discipline. To achieve this it is good practice to have exact wording of a question held constant from year to year to analyze trends and also to have multiple questions to facilitate put the research within a certain context. These two practices come in handy when interpreting the poll results. British Empire and American Revolution - Essay ExampleLater the Sugar act was reformed and tax was slashed to 3 pence a pound with new customs service .There was huge resistance in paying tax and towards the end of 1766, the tax was reduced to a cent for a barrel. Stamp Act of 1765 was another policy reformation declaring tax on that legal documents, newspapers, pamphlets, playing cards, and hand bills. A stamp is affixed to stand the tax payment. Colonies revolted against Stamp Act and threatened to boycott British goods. The British parliament revoked the stamp act in 1766 due to colonial pressure barely reinstating parliamentary supremacy by passing the declaratory act. There were duties imposed on paper, paint, lead, glass, and teatime imported into the colonies leading to colonial boycotts hampering the trade by 50%.Boston Massacre in 1770 was a reactive outburst of tension developed between British soldiers and the local crowd. The crowd was throwing snowballs at British sold iers and panic-struck soldiers killed 5 people. Boston Massacre coat way for the emergence of committees for correspondence .These committees gained more momentum by destroying the British colonial assets like ships. Monopoly on tea was granted in 1773 by parliament as a resource plan to rescue the East India corporation from financial crisis. This act enabled East India Company to handle both the shipping and the sale of its tea, thereby decreasing the price of tea. This created havoc in colonies and they boycotted tea to express their revolt. Angered by the colonial revolts, Britain brass introduced Coercive Acts, in 1774 closing Boston port, transferring the colonial trials to other colonies or Britain and enabling the soldiers to reside in private homes and finally revoking the self government in Massachusetts. Britain aimed at isolation of colonies by introducing Coercive Acts but on the contrary the act united the colonies to a greater extent leading to formation of prime (prenominal) Continental congress boycotting English goods. The year 1775 and 1776 witnessed clear outburst of colonies towards British Colonial policies leading to death of nearly 73 Britain Warriors.Thus the above cited incidences paved for the revolt process with greater degree of resistance and colonies evolved as a battalion to combat against the British colonial policy and they succeeded in their mission subsequently the war of American Independence leading to liberalization of colonies.BibliographyGipson, Lawrence Henry.
